What are the requirements for V4 verification 2023 2024?

The V4 and V5 groups will be required to submit proof of identity and a signed statement of educational purpose (SEP); however, they will no longer be able to use expired documents for proof of identity. In addition, Identity documents must be presented in the financial aid office at the time the SEP is signed.

How do I verify my FAFSA for 2023 24?

In most cases, due to the IRS Data Retrieval Tool for the 2023–24 FAFSA form, you won't have to verify income and tax information. However, if you are selected for verification, the school may ask you to submit a tax transcript or other documentation to confirm the information you reported.

What is the income limit for FAFSA 2024?

What Are the FAFSA Income Limits for 2024? Both students and their parents often think their household income makes them ineligible for financial aid. However, there's no income limit for the FAFSA, and the U.S. Department of Education does not have an income cap for federal financial aid.

Is it too late to apply for FAFSA 2023 2024?

The Federal Deadline

Our only time limit is that each year the FAFSA form for that particular academic year becomes unavailable after June 30. That means that the 2023–24 FAFSA form will disappear from StudentAid.gov on June 30, 2024, because that's the end of the 2023–24 school year.

How long does it take for FAFSA verification?

How long does the verification process take? Verification processing time is generally two to three weeks during peak season (June-October), and one to two weeks during non-peak season (November-May). Therefore, students should start the process as soon as possible.

What is V1 verification FAFSA?

Students who are selected for verification will be placed in one of the following groups to determine which FAFSA information must be verified. V1—Standard Verification Group. Students in this group must verify the following if they are tax filers: Adjusted gross income. U.S. income tax paid.

What is the V4 custom verification?

Custom Verification Group (V4) Page 1. Custom Verification Group (V4) Your FAFSA was selected by the Federal Government for the CUSTOM GROUP VERIFICATION to verify your High. School Completion Status and Identity/Statement of Educational Purpose.

Who is an independent student for FAFSA 2023 2024?

For the 2023–2024 Award Year, a student is automatically determined to be independent for federal student aid purposes if he or she meets one or more of the following criteria: The student was born before January 1, 2000. The student is married or separated (but not divorced) as of the date of the application.
